Phoenix CPF urges community to report crime
Updated | By Lauren Beukes
A Community Policing Forum (CPF) in Phoenix, north of Durban, has encouraged community members to share information about wrongdoing in their area saying this will help authorities make swift arrests.

On Friday, a suspected drug dealer and his wife were arrested at a property on Wareham Place and seized guns, ammunition, phones, video recorders and heroin capsules from a total of three suspects.

The forum's Umesh Singh says Phoenix has its issues like other communities, but with teamwork from residents - they claim back their area.
"The community plays a very vital role in crime-fighting with them constantly passing on information about drugs and drug-related incidents. With specific details, it all helps, and it gives us direction to work on," he said.
